X20C04 512 x 8 Bit Nonvolatile Static RAM • High reliability 1,000,000 nonvolatile store operations 100 years minimum • Power-on recall data automatically recalled into SRAM upon power-up • Lock out inadvertent store operations • Low power CMOS 250µA • EEPROM array recall, and RAM read and write cycles • Compatible with X2004 The Xicor X20C04 is a 512 x 8 NOVRAM featuring a t static RAM overlaid bit-for-bit with a nonvolatile electri- cally erasable PROM EEPROM . The X20C04 is fabricated with advanced CMOS gate technology c to achieve low power and wide power-supply margin. The X20C04 features the JEDEC approved pinout for byte-wide memories, compatible with industry stan- u dard RAMs, ROMs, EPROMs, and EEPROMs. The NOVRAM design allows data to be easily transferred d from RAM to EEPROM store and EEPROM to RAM recall . The store operation is completed in 5ms or less and the recall operation is completed in 5µs or less. o Xicor NOVRAMS are designed for unlimited write r operations to RAM, either from the host or recalls from EEPROM, and a minimum 1,000,000 store operations Pto the EEPROM.
